Kayvdoon - we actually dont *need* to eat a single carb - ever. Our body will convert the fat that we eat (and have stored) into useable energy. Its true that our brains use carbs - but because they are usually readily available. Carbs are not the only source of brain "fuel". People are capable, of not only surviving on extremely low carbs, but of thriving. Even endurance athletes (lile ultra runners who run 50 to 100+ miles at one time) can thrive on extremely low carb diets.
